I was browsing on My Quilt Place and saw the quilt on Bonnie Sneed's page; went to her site and she had posted some helps to go along on how she made it; I just copied the picture, took it to Staples and had them blow it up real big. Mine differs from hers in the border of animals in squares. The fabric is from a series of Jungle Babies designed by Patty Reed; you can still find some in Joann stores but I had to go to several different stores to get what I needed. Thanks!

Thank you! Yes, forgot to mention hand quilting the expression and brow line, and embroidered the eyes. The flannel was from a series called "Jungle Babies" designed by Patty Reed; I found at Joanns but had to go to several stores to get what I needed, they may be phasing out? not sure; tiger print for borders also from that series; I noticed Walmart carries a line of it but in different color tones. I also found the panel print showing large animals that Bonnie got the idea from and I am just going to starch it stiffly so it can be hung on the wall for baby to see. It is adorable!
